I don't think LLMs replace thinking, but rather elevate it. When I use an LLM, I’m still doing the intellectual work, but I’m freed from the mechanics of writing. It’s similar to programming in C instead of assembly: I’m operating at a higher level of abstraction, focusing more on what I want to say than how to say it. |
